怎么给你玩的游戏加密怎么给你玩的游戏加密

怎么给你玩的游戏加密怎么给你玩的游戏加密,

本文目录导读:

  1. 游戏加密的基本概念
  2. 游戏加密的常用技术
  3. 游戏加密的应用场景
  4. 游戏加密的未来趋势

随着游戏行业的发展,加密技术在游戏开发中的应用越来越重要,从游戏内容的保护到玩家数据的安全,加密技术已经成为保障游戏体验和玩家权益的关键技术,本文将从游戏加密的基本概念、常用技术、应用场景以及未来趋势等方面进行详细探讨。

游戏加密的基本概念

游戏加密是指对游戏内容、数据和用户信息进行加密处理,以防止未经授权的访问和泄露,加密技术通过将数据转换为不可读的形式,使得只有经过特定解密的用户才能访问原始内容,这种方法不仅保护了游戏的商业机密,还确保了玩家数据的安全。

游戏加密的主要目标包括:

  1. 数据保护:防止游戏内容被未经授权的第三方获取和使用。
  2. 防止数据泄露:保护玩家个人信息,防止被恶意利用。
  3. 确保数据完整性:防止游戏数据被篡改或损坏。
  4. 认证与授权:验证玩家身份,确保他们拥有合法的访问权限。

游戏加密的常用技术

对称加密(Symmetric Encryption)

对称加密是加密技术中最常用的一种方法,它使用相同的密钥对数据进行加密和解密,由于密钥长度较短,对称加密在处理大量数据时效率较高,但密钥的管理需要严格控制,否则可能导致数据泄露。

在游戏加密中,对称加密常用于以下场景:

  • 游戏数据的加密(如MOD文件、插件)
  • 玩家角色数据的加密(如头像、角色属性)
  • 游戏通信数据的加密(如聊天、交易)

非对称加密(Asymmetric Encryption)

非对称加密使用一对不同的密钥:公钥和私钥,公钥用于加密数据,私钥用于解密数据,由于公钥和私钥是不同的,非对称加密在数据传输中非常安全,但加密和解密过程相对缓慢。

在游戏加密中,非对称加密常用于以下场景:

  • 用户身份验证(如登录、注册)
  • 加密通信(如游戏内消息传输)
  • 数字签名(确保数据的完整性和真实性)

加密哈希(Hashing)

加密哈希是一种单向加密技术,用于将输入数据转换为固定长度的哈希值,哈希值具有不可逆性,无法从哈希值恢复出原始数据,加密哈希常用于验证数据完整性和身份认证。

在游戏加密中,哈希技术常用于以下场景:

  • 游戏内数据的签名(防止篡改)
  • 用户密码存储(防止密码泄露)
  • 游戏内资产的唯一标识

水印技术

水印技术是一种用于在数字内容中嵌入水印的加密技术,水印可以用于识别内容的来源,防止未经授权的复制和传播,水印技术在游戏加密中常用于以下场景:

  • 保护游戏内容的版权
  • 防止盗版游戏的传播
  • 识别游戏的发行渠道

游戏加密的应用场景

游戏MOD加密

MOD(Modification)是许多游戏支持的文件格式,用于修改游戏内容,由于MOD文件通常包含敏感信息,如游戏数据、插件资源等,因此对MOD文件进行加密是非常重要的。

游戏MOD加密技术通常采用对称加密或非对称加密技术,以确保MOD文件的安全,使用加密哈希技术对MOD文件进行签名,确保文件内容的完整性和真实性。

游戏插件加密

游戏插件是许多游戏社区中非常受欢迎的功能,允许玩家自定义游戏体验,由于插件通常包含大量的数据和脚本,因此对插件进行加密是非常必要的。

游戏插件加密技术通常采用对称加密或非对称加密技术,以确保插件文件的安全,使用加密哈希技术对插件文件进行签名,确保文件内容的完整性和真实性。

游戏通信加密

在游戏中,玩家之间的通信是非常敏感的,任何未经授权的第三方都可能窃取这些信息,对游戏通信进行加密是非常重要的。

游戏通信加密技术通常采用对称加密或非对称加密技术,以确保通信的安全,使用加密哈希技术对通信内容进行签名,确保消息的完整性和真实性。

游戏数据保护

游戏数据的保护是游戏加密的核心内容,游戏数据包括MOD文件、插件、用户数据等,这些数据一旦被泄露,可能导致严重的后果。

游戏数据保护技术通常采用对称加密、非对称加密或哈希技术,以确保数据的安全,使用加密哈希技术对游戏数据进行签名,确保数据的完整性和真实性。

游戏加密的未来趋势

随着游戏行业的发展,游戏加密技术也在不断进步,游戏加密技术的发展方向包括:

  1. 区块链技术的应用:区块链技术可以用于实现游戏数据的不可篡改性和透明性,从而提高游戏数据的安全性。
  2. 人工智能与加密结合:人工智能技术可以用于优化加密算法,提高加密效率和安全性。
  3. 多因素认证:多因素认证技术可以用于进一步增强游戏数据的安全性,防止单一因素被攻击。
  4. 分发的安全性提升:随着游戏内容的分发渠道越来越多样化,游戏加密技术需要适应新的分发场景,确保数据的安全性。

游戏加密是保障游戏行业健康发展的重要技术,通过采用对称加密、非对称加密、哈希技术和水印技术等方法,可以有效保护游戏数据、玩家信息和游戏内容的安全,随着技术的发展,游戏加密技术将更加成熟,为游戏行业的发展提供更坚实的保障。

怎么给你玩的游戏加密怎么给你玩的游戏加密,

发表评论